Maritime Day Merchant Marine Memorial Wreath Laying Ceremony
Thursday, May 22, 2008
Riverfront Park, Water Street, Wilmington, NC 28401: The Merchant Marine Memorial wreath laying ceremony honors the memory and the service of Merchant Mariners who gave their lives in service to their country. Of the 243,000 Merchant Mariners who served in World War II, more than 9,500 died â€" the highest casualty rate of all the U.S. services. The wreath is carefully handed to the crew of the U.S. Coast Guard boat, who proceed to the center of the river and lay it in the water, as buglers play ''Echo Taps'' and the flags of all branches of the service dip in salute. Kure Beach Double Sprint Triathlon 2008
Sunday, June 29, 2008 (8am)
Kure Beach: The very first ''Formula 1'' or super sprint style triathlon in the U.S. The Kure Beach Double Sprint is now in it's 12th year. Competitors start out with a 375 meter ocean swim. Upon exiting the water, participants put on their running gear at the ''Beach Transition Area'' and run 1.5 miles to the ''Town Hall Transition Area''. Participants then complete a 10K bike ride on a closed course. With no rest - participants immediately ride the 10 K bike course again finishing at the ''Town Hall Transition Area''. Then it's back on with the running gear for the 1.5 mile run back to the ''Beach Transition Area''. Participants complete the race by once again swimming the 375 meter course. This event benefits Leukemia & Lymphoma Society and Pleasure Island Sea Turlte Project.

Wooden Boat Festival
Saturday, July 26, 2008
CFCC Campus; Riverfront, Water Street, Wilmington, NC 28401: Presented by the CFCC Boat Building program, the festival serves as an annual celebration of the tradition and craft of wooden boat building. CFCC's wooden boat festival attracts thousands of visitors every year. This year, the event will feature over 50 wooden boats, including kayaks, skiffs, and boats from the Simmons Sea Skiff Club. Students in CFCC's Boat Building program will exhibit their own work and conduct demonstrations of traditional boat building techniques like bending wood using steam. Build Your Own Boat!
